DOUGLAS POFF

SPENCERVILLE — Douglas E. Poff, 63, of Spencerville, died Tuesday morning, July 21, 2015 at his residence following a sudden illness.

He was born October 20, 1951 in Lima, the son Charles Edward and Arnaville Louise Mowery Poff, who are deceased.

He is survived by his significant friend Carol E. Mays of Spencerville; one son ; Jody (Alison) Poff of St. Marys and his four granddaughters; Tannar, Morgan, Jersey and Jada Poff; two sisters; Sharon Williams of Spencerville and Sheila (Bill) Archer of Wapakoneta and several nieces and nephews.

He was preceded in death by two sisters; Mary Ann Ziegenbusch and Charlene Sweenty.

Doug was a graduate of Spencerville High School and went on to work many years at the former Hayes-Albion/Trim Trends Corp. in Spencerville in its Quality Control System. He was a member of the Delphos Eagles Aerie # 471. He enjoyed camping and fishing and the Cincinnati Bengals and any other kind of football.
